Insulin Pump Start Packages
Medtronic 780g with SmartGuard | Tandem t:slim with Control IQ | YpsoPump with CamAPS
An insulin pump start package costs $500. This includes the initial half day setup and commencement, a follow up appointment either in person or via telehealth, one month’s worth of email/phone contact as required and all administration costs. The initial appointment is set to a half day as they usually require education around Continuous Glucose Monitoring (CGM) and also hybrid closed loop therapy. We’d like to ensure you are confident in your use of the system, and not anxious or uncertain when you leave your appointment.
Omnipod Dash
As Omniod does not link with a continuous glucose monitor and has no Hybrid Closed Loop technology, these appointment require less education and time. An Omnipod Dash pump start package will cost $450 ($300 initial appointment and $150 for the follow up). This includes the setup and commencement appointment, a follow up appointment either in person or via telehealth, one month’s worth of email/phone contact as required and all administration costs.
